Oscillators are electronic devices that can generate and sustain repeating waveforms, either as an audible tone or an electrical signal. The 7Q-16.367667MBN-T oscillator is a type of crystal oscillator, and is employed in a number of applications.

In general, crystal oscillators work by taking advantage of the piezoelectric effect. This effect occurs when crystals, usually cut in a shape known as a quartz plate or wafer, experience an electrical voltage applied to them. This voltage causes a deformation in the surface of the crystal, creating an electrical charge which rapidly changes polarity and produces a current. This current creates a rapid mechanically induced vibration in the quartz crystal, resulting in a sine wave oscillation. This type of oscillation can be fine-tuned to a specific frequency by changing the thickness and angles of the quartz plates.
